Add compiler macros and compilation sanity-checks for functions with keywords. 2010-10-25 Aidan Kehoe <kehoea@parhasard.net> Add compiler macros and compilation sanity-checking for various functions that take keywords. * byte-optimize.el (side-effect-free-fns): #'symbol-value is side-effect free and not error free. * bytecomp.el (byte-compile-normal-call): Check keyword argument lists for sanity; store information about the positions where keyword arguments start using the new byte-compile-keyword-start property. * cl-macs.el (cl-const-expr-val): Take a new optional argument, cl-not-constant, defaulting to nil, in this function; return it if the expression is not constant. (cl-non-fixnum-number-p): Make this into a separate function, we want to pass it to #'every. (eql): Use it. (define-star-compiler-macros): Use the same code to generate the member*, assoc* and rassoc* compiler macros; special-case some code in #'add-to-list in subr.el. (remove, remq): Add compiler macros for these two functions, in preparation for #'remove being in C. (define-foo-if-compiler-macros): Transform (remove-if-not ...) calls to (remove ... :if-not) at compile time, which will be a real win once the latter is in C. (define-substitute-if-compiler-macros) (define-subst-if-compiler-macros): Similarly for these functions. (delete-duplicates): Change this compiler macro to use #'plists-equal; if we don't have information about the type of SEQUENCE at compile time, don't bother attempting to inline the call, the function will be in C soon enough. (equalp): Remove an old commented-out compiler macro for this, if we want to see it it's in version control. (subst-char-in-string): Transform this to a call to nsubstitute or nsubstitute, if that is appropriate. * cl.el (ldiff): Don't call setf here, this makes for a load-time dependency problem in cl-macs.el

/* Commentary:

According to Paul Keusemann in <20070802140358.GA19566@visi.com>, this
feature probably still works as of 2007-08-02.  However, that doesn't seem
reliable since there doesn't seem to be a way to configure it! */

#include <config.h>
#include "lisp.h"

/* ####

  The following junk used to be in lisp/prim/files.el.  It obviously
  doesn't belong there, but should go somewhere.

  (if (fboundp 'ut-log-text)	;; #### Sun stuff; what is this?
      (ut-log-text "Reading a file."))
*/

/* Whether usage tracking is turned on (Sun only) */
Lisp_Object Vusage_tracking;
#ifdef USAGE_TRACKING
#include <ut.h>
#endif

DEFUN ("ut-log-text", Fut_log_text, 1, MANY, 0, /*
Log a usage-tracking message if `usage-tracking' is non-nil.
Args are the same as to `format'.  Returns whether the message was
actually logged.  If usage-tracking support was not compiled in, this
function has no effect and always returns `nil'.  See function
`has-usage-tracking-p'.
*/
#ifdef USAGE_TRACKING
       (int nargs, Lisp_Object *args)
#else
       (int UNUSED (nargs), Lisp_Object *UNUSED (args))
#endif
       )
{
#ifdef USAGE_TRACKING
  Lisp_Object xs;
  unsigned char *s;

  if (!NILP (Vusage_tracking))
    {
      xs = Fformat (nargs, args);
      CHECK_STRING (xs);
      s = XSTRING_DATA (xs);
      ut_log_text ((char *) s);
    }
  return Vusage_tracking;
#else
  return Qnil;
#endif
}


/************************************************************************/
/*                            initialization                            */
/************************************************************************/

void
syms_of_sunpro (void)
{
  DEFSUBR (Fut_log_text);
}

void
vars_of_sunpro (void)
{
  DEFVAR_LISP ("usage-tracking", &Vusage_tracking /*
Whether usage tracking is turned on (Sun internal use only).
Has no effect if usage tracking support has not been compiled in.
*/ );
  Vusage_tracking = Qnil;

  Fprovide (intern ("sparcworks"));
#ifdef USAGE_TRACKING
  Fprovide (intern ("usage-tracking"));
#endif
}

void
init_sunpro (void)
{
  Vusage_tracking = Qnil;
#ifdef USAGE_TRACKING
  if (!purify_flag)
    {	       /* Enabled only when not dumping an executable */
      Vusage_tracking = Qt;
      ut_initialize ("xemacs", NULL, NULL);
    }
#endif
}
